Output 43d56e807f1183aff6fa4aac6bfbb395e91a3506cc2d94b552f3592c622f6300:1

value
106734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c6486861af238d262d2a02197813d8b21ff90bd OP_EQUALVERIFY OP_CHECKSIG
address
128XXwES2MFHT8SJeSGtJNHemirdg6T4f5
transaction
43d56e807f1183aff6fa4aac6bfbb395e91a3506cc2d94b552f3592c622f6300
confirmations
103676
spent
true